Young athletes recently gathered in Crossabeg-Ballymurn for a GAA Cúl Camp, a youth sports program focused on Gaelic games. The event provided participants with the opportunity to develop their skills in hurling, camogie, and Gaelic football through structured coaching sessions.
These camps are held annually across Ireland to encourage physical activity and foster community engagement among children. By offering a mix of training and social interaction, the program aims to introduce young players to the fundamentals of the sports while promoting the values of the Gaelic Athletic Association.
